Hello, have a question similar to one asked about center points for area information display. One of my "center" points keeps locating at the corner of the rectangle rather than somewhere in the middle of the floor. Please see the image below if you have answers about this. Thank you!

Hmmm...neither. The technique used is to array points on a surface and to choose the point farthest from the reference curve. As you can see in the image above, points that should show up on the outer curve for the hut area do not appear. So, a point away from the curve is not chosen.
Arie Willem de Jongh over 2 years ago
I think I understand what's happening. There are no points that are on the inside of the curve boundary for the HUT. This is why it chooses a point on the boundary. The easiest way to solve this is to increase the U and V inputs from the Surface Divide component (default is 10, slowly increase it to 20 or something and be careful as it will slow down calculations, so don't use a to big of a number).
